Sr. Quality Control Analyst

Pace® Analytical ServicesWaltham, MA
$105,000 - $120,000Onsite

About The Position

Lead formulation and process development for innovative drug products. Provide expert guidance on material and product evaluation using advanced technical knowledge. Design scalable formulations for small molecules and biologics in early-stage clinical trials. Optimize manufacturing processes and interpret analytical data to drive strategic decisions.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s, Master’s, or PhD degree in Chemistry, Biology, or a related field (advanced degree preferred).
  • 5+ years in a laboratory setting with demonstrated expertise in analytical methods and formulation development.
  • 3+ years of technical writing experience, including GMP SOP development.
  • Strong organizational, leadership, and communication abilities.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ously; self-motivated and results-driven.
  • Proficiency with Office 365 and laboratory instrument software
  • Independent in time management and project planning
  • Collaborative, detail-oriented, and committed to quality and compliance.

Responsibilities

  • Analyze and interpret complex chemistry, biochemistry, and formulation data to identify trends and provide actionable insights to management and/or clients.
  • Develop, validate, and transfer analytical methods; perform routine and advanced testing using instruments such as HPLC, GC, LC-MS, FTIR, and ddPCR.
  • Design and develop robust, scalable formulations for small molecules and biologics in early-stage clinical trials; optimize manufacturing processes for drug products.
  • Write and review GMP SOPs
  • Conduct analytical testing following SOPs, regulatory guidelines, and GMP standards.
  • Train and mentor team members on analytical methods, instrumentation, and best practices, as required
  • Collaborate across teams to improve efficiency and deliver high-quality results.
  • Promote a positive, customer-focused environment aligned with Pace®’s mission.
